Author: jfeinauer
Date: Sat Jan 4 19:35:23 2020
New Revision: 37454
Log:
Staged RC1 for Build Tools 1.1.0
Added:
dev/plc4x/build-tools/code-generation/1.1.0/
dev/plc4x/build-tools/code-generation/1.1.0/rc1/
dev/plc4x/build-tools/code-generation/1.1.0/rc1/README
dev/plc4x/build-tools/code-generation/1.1.0/rc1/RELEASE_NOTES
dev/plc4x/build-tools/code-generation/1.1.0/rc1/plc4x-code-generaton-1.1.0-source-release.zip
(with props)
dev/plc4x/build-tools/code-generation/1.1.0/rc1/plc4x-code-generaton-1.1.0-source-release.zip.asc
dev/plc4x/build-tools/code-generation/1.1.0/rc1/plc4x-code-generaton-1.1.0-source-release.zip.sha512
Added: dev/plc4x/build-tools/code-generation/1.1.0/rc1/README
==============================================================================
--- dev/plc4x/build-tools/code-generation/1.1.0/rc1/README (added)
+++ dev/plc4x/build-tools/code-generation/1.1.0/rc1/README Sat Jan 4 19:35:23
2020
@@ -0,0 +1,47 @@
+Apache PLC4X Build-Tools
+========================
+
+Apache PLC4X Build-Tools is a sub-project of the Apache PLC4X project and
contains
+all the tools needed to build the main project.
+
+Currently the only tool it contains is a maven plugin used to generate drivers.
+
+It currently doesn't contain any actual code-generation modules, but just the
plugin
+and the API required to load and use code-generation modules.
+
+The actual code-generation modules are located inside the main project.
+
+Environment
+-----------
+
+Currently the project is configured to require the following software:
+
+1) Java 8 JDK: For running Maven in general as well as compiling the Java and
Scala
+modules `JAVA_HOME` configured to point to that.
+
+
+Getting Started
+---------------
+
+Normally you wouldn't be required to build this module as the artifacts it
produces
+will be made available via one of the maven repositories. However if you want
to improve
+or fix the existing tools, you will have to build your version locally.
+
+You must have Java 8 installed on your system and connectivity to Maven Central
+(for downloading external third party dependencies). Maven will be
automatically
+downloaded and installed by the maven wrapper `mvnw`.
+
+Build PLC4X Java jars and install them in your local maven repository
+
+$ ./mvnw install
+
+This should make the build-tools available to the main projects build.
+In order to use your locally built version of the build-tools you should
+update the property: `plc4x-code-generation.version` in the PLC4X main pom.xml.
+
+
+
+Licensing
+---------
+
+Apache PLC4X is released under the Apache License Version 2.0.
Added: dev/plc4x/build-tools/code-generation/1.1.0/rc1/RELEASE_NOTES
==============================================================================
--- dev/plc4x/build-tools/code-generation/1.1.0/rc1/RELEASE_NOTES (added)
+++ dev/plc4x/build-tools/code-generation/1.1.0/rc1/RELEASE_NOTES Sat Jan 4
19:35:23 2020
@@ -0,0 +1,38 @@
+==============================================================
+Apache PLC4X Build-Tools Code-Generation 1.1.0
+==============================================================
+
+New Features
+------------
+- Added new Integer and Float type references
+- Added support for "dataIo" types in MSpec
+- Added support for temporal fields
+- Added support for string fields
+
+Incompatible changes
+--------------------
+
+Bug Fixes
+---------
+
+==============================================================
+Apache PLC4X Build-Tools Code-Generation 1.0.0
+==============================================================
+
+This is the first official release of Apache PLC4X
+Build-Tools Code-Generation.
+
+New Features
+------------
+
+- New `plc4x-maven-plugin`
+
+Incompatible changes
+--------------------
+
+- none
+
+Bug Fixes
+---------
+
+- none
Added:
dev/plc4x/build-tools/code-generation/1.1.0/rc1/plc4x-code-generaton-1.1.0-source-release.zip
==============================================================================
Binary file - no diff available.
Propchange:
dev/plc4x/build-tools/code-generation/1.1.0/rc1/plc4x-code-generaton-1.1.0-source-release.zip
------------------------------------------------------------------------------
svn:mime-type = application/octet-stream
Added:
dev/plc4x/build-tools/code-generation/1.1.0/rc1/plc4x-code-generaton-1.1.0-source-release.zip.asc
==============================================================================
---
dev/plc4x/build-tools/code-generation/1.1.0/rc1/plc4x-code-generaton-1.1.0-source-release.zip.asc
(added)
+++
dev/plc4x/build-tools/code-generation/1.1.0/rc1/plc4x-code-generaton-1.1.0-source-release.zip.asc
Sat Jan 4 19:35:23 2020
@@ -0,0 +1,16 @@
+-----BEGIN PGP SIGNATURE-----
+
+iQIzBAABCgAdFiEErb1CjLW/bJ/8d7kHwzbgFDpVO4kFAl4Q5hoACgkQwzbgFDpV
+O4kX0hAAsa0A1T6atVUNGjQU9i6LOsD5AXFTzW4Q+yBmjni7XoYXYakOtdOOJv3Z
+qRW3iz3Dqyp+7H+mglR/3AFkTKfUi3K+sF7wvuVbZxeAjH7dUXFegcR73G5dKQgu
++RtLa7gKK9nky2/a0eL5e+ABg+JSdWg/sNUFCxr9LTVCVnpseED61Fm5jA13zuhz
+6QGu3yZY32XaGCdVqncfBa+LTg3TYp5UX+fZgafyXt7O8aizAkp0woNXnxrdoJm2
+pyNiFhkub3dlZAhB1Yjw87TmmdUeyWig7lxEqRVrFl8h8Vu31MZi2AmYufxS23Vx
+blyoJCaASZTqBncsSpJxgDth6gBKznqwj9zawShG79j3owlhd3iUIVojuE18BxpT
+Y9qZgep8+8F75ZhRw0pb1kwF95W9yk045XgdD3LoJ+69GoOtZWoS2AmDx6I4z83T
+sRiiZlHAZ6XeehL3TSyR0NzT/UeFB07wUyngPRnlDZ5wnBObl0gQ3cDriWKsFYnH
+MY/His+xTkitB0AHEAIXI8y/K9NmfIpQO9dzbtEmLI/fXy2/sXiDKFLuDEmxf+ku
+yUTm9gb8HzHcB8D19FR7vKNNlZd/oRxrPjXOY886PPXe5NSWn4PDQ4l0eL7r/9G7
++MFjLkqdE6J+Dbm/4n4EZJzpzg6T64ataBADjt0ENskw8ZyJb1A=
+=gE4h
+-----END PGP SIGNATURE-----
Added:
dev/plc4x/build-tools/code-generation/1.1.0/rc1/plc4x-code-generaton-1.1.0-source-release.zip.sha512
==============================================================================
---
dev/plc4x/build-tools/code-generation/1.1.0/rc1/plc4x-code-generaton-1.1.0-source-release.zip.sha512
(added)
+++
dev/plc4x/build-tools/code-generation/1.1.0/rc1/plc4x-code-generaton-1.1.0-source-release.zip.sha512
Sat Jan 4 19:35:23 2020
@@ -0,0 +1 @@
+28a9ed8b3f72b5fe782576628f531861a043747f8e3293740ffd1da355e5df41a01bc6e179fe58909f75085b77d8e2c9144f800b2784294f682c01e299f31d6c
\ No newline at end of file